I used to live the convenience of Über. The app revolutionized travel. But with each recent update to the app, Über removes the brilliant features that made Über such a convenient and friendly service. The most recent change has made it nearly unusable for travel away from home. Über used to allow you to enter the name if your pickup location. This was particularly valuable when traveling and for situations where the GPS would identify your location incorrectly by as much as 50m / 150ft. In those cases, Über might think you were down the street or on a nearby street instead of at the entrance to your hotel. Now, Über gives you no option to enter the name of your pickup place, such as the name of a hotel or nearby business. When Uber asks you to confirm your pickup location, it gives you an address. In many cities around the world, addresses are not visible on the street, and if you are in the middle of a block, you might have no idea what the name of the street is (and in some cities, streets have two different official names). So if you are standing outside of the XYZ Hotel, and you dont know the street number or name, its kind of useless when Über tells you to meet your driver at ### Ave, especially since the GPS can be off by more than 100 feet in a crowded city street. Yesterday and today I tried six separate times o use Uber, and in every case, Uber gave me a pickup address I could not locate. In only one of those was there an identifiable reference point on the Uber map, and even then, the driver picked me up about 100 feet away from the confirmed pickup spot. I ended up getting a taxi for the other five trips, including one from the hotel this morning. In that case, I tried two separate times to get a pickup, and Uber asked me to confirm a pickup location in two different streets. Uber has also taken away important features that made the app incredibly useful. If you dont rate a driver before your next trip, you can only use the app to provide a rating for your most recent trip (or report an issue, or leave a comment, etc). If you want to leave a rating or feedback for an earlier trip, you have to use a browser and manually log into your account. The same is true if you want to contact support or report an issue with the app. The value and power of the app is that you can do everything you need in the app, and not have to switch to a different map to look up an address or your mobile devices browser to log into your account. I use Uber a lot for business travel, but lately, I have used it a lot less because its simply far less functional than it used to be. Maybe its time to check out Lyft?
